Transaction e3caee610e46f2fd95a9cf39e2562567d30500c97cda135b71fc80bb070c1e30
1 Input
2 Outputs
- e3caee610e46f2fd95a9cf39e2562567d30500c97cda135b71fc80bb070c1e30:0
- e3caee610e46f2fd95a9cf39e2562567d30500c97cda135b71fc80bb070c1e30:1
value 11112726
address 3NRYX2Cn1MWMyfY8TvQxxi9DxqUo69AeCm
value 1460017161
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b